Abstract

The utility model discloses a multifunctional near infrared spectrum monitor and relates to the technical field of near infrared light detection. The multifunctional near infrared spectrum monitor comprises a spectrum information acquirer and a data storage and processing host, wherein the acquirer and the host are connected through a data line, the acquirer comprises an acquisition probe and a handle, a safety lock and a spring are arranged on the handle, and a trigger, a chute, a sliding plate and a control plate are arranged at the lower portion of the acquisition probe. One end of the spring is fixed on the handle, the other end of the spring is connected with the trigger, the chute is arranged at the bottom of the acquisition probe, the sliding plate is placed on the chute, and the sliding plate is detachably connected with the control plate. The multifunctional near infrared spectrum monitor has the advantages that the control plate for fixing an object to be detected is arranged on the acquisition probe, one-hand detection of the monitor is achieved, and the operability is good. The control plate and the sliding plate are connected detachably, and the control plates in different shapes are changed according to the actual situation. The control plates can be vertical plates or spoon-shaped plates according to different detected objects, the objects to be detected are fixed well, and monitoring is facilitated.

Background technology
At present, adopt near infrared light spectrum monitoring instrument can realize quick, the non-destructive Real-Time Monitoring of thing to be detected.Utilize near-infrared spectrum technique fast, nondestructively to detect fruit internal quality as pol, acidity and degree of ripeness; Can monitor plant leaf nutritive element content; Also can monitor soil nutrient content, be a kind of efficient detection technique means.In recent years, near infrared light spectrum monitoring instrument is applied to the use that fruit quality detection, plant leaf nutrient composition content detect and soil nutrient content detects research starts to focus on portable spectrometer, the portable near infrared spectrum monitoring instrument of emphasis on development, the variation of Real-Time Monitoring fruit interior quality in growth and development of fruit tree process, for cultivation of fruit tree management and timely collecting provide scientific basis; Detection to fruit tree leaf nutritive element content in real time, grasps fruit tree nutrition upgrowth situation, understands the rich scarce situation of fruit tree nutrition; Whether the monitoring to soil nutrient content, be convenient to grasp soil nutrient and lack, for growth and development of fruit tree provides good control measures in real time.When the monitoring to soil nutrient content, be generally that the aluminium box that the pedotheque preparing is put into certain depth (dark 2cm more than) is monitored.There is following problem in current portable spectrometer:
1. very inconvenient when thing to be detected is detected, can not one-handed performance, need the fixing thing to be detected of a hand, another hand is aimed at thing to be detected by harvester and is detected.
2. the surface of contact of acquisition probe and thing to be detected is not tight, occurs the interference phenomenon of light leak or extraneous ground unrest, does not meet precision and conditional request that spectrometer detects.
In sum, be necessary to design a kind of field monitoring of being convenient to, the near infrared light spectrum monitoring instrument that is not vulnerable to external environmental interference and can be fixed thing to be detected, to address the above problem.

Embodiment
Below with reference to accompanying drawing, the utility model is elaborated, as shown in Figure 1 and Figure 2:
Near infrared light spectrum monitoring instrument of the present utility model, comprise spectral information collector 1 and data storage host 2, spectral information collector 1 is connected by data line 3 with data storage host 2, spectral information collector 1 comprises acquisition probe 11, handle 12 and camera lens 13, and the handle 12 of spectral information collector 1 is provided with locking device 121.Locking device 121 comprises safety lock 1211 and spring 1212.Acquisition probe 11 bottoms are provided with trigger 111, chute 112, sliding panel 113 and control panel 114.Wherein, one end of spring 1212 is fixed on handle 12, and the other end is connected with trigger 111.Trigger 111 is flexibly connected with spring 1212 and sliding panel 113 respectively.Safety lock 1211 is used for controlling locking spring 1212 in tightening up state, and safety lock 1211 arranges spring 1212 upper left sides.Chute 112 is arranged on acquisition probe 11 bottoms, is placed with sliding panel 113 on chute 112, and sliding panel 113 is connected with control panel 114 is detachable.Thing to be detected can be fruit, leaf blade or the container that soil is housed.When detecting thing to be detected, testing staff holds collector 1, opens safety lock 1211, pull sliding panel 113, thing to be detected is placed between control panel 114 and camera lens 13, and under the pulling force effect of spring 1212, control panel 114 draws thing to be detected to camera lens 13 directions, thing to be detected is fixed, do not need manually to use hand saver thing to be detected, be convenient to detect, make thing to be detected be close to camera lens 13 yet simultaneously, prevent light leak, avoid the impact of external environment light on testing result.When completing detection; collector 1 leaves thing to be detected; testing staff's cocking 111; under the pulling force effect of spring 1212, sliding panel 113 is retracted to initial position; safety lock 1211 snaps on the otch on sliding panel 113; control panel 114 is buckled on camera lens 13, can be used for len 13, prevents that dust from entering.
Further improvement as technique scheme, outside camera lens 13, be provided with circular sucker 115, the near infrared light that send acquisition probe 11 inside sees through sucker 115 and is irradiated to thing to be detected, and sucker 115 can prevent light leak, also can make thing to be detected and camera lens 13 more fit.
Further improvement as technique scheme, above-mentioned control panel 114 is vertical plate, vertical plate can be fixed thing to be detected, sliding panel 113 and control panel 114 adopt detachable connection, vertical control panel 114 is connected on sliding panel 113, when thing to be detected is that leaf blade or the container that soil is housed are better with vertical control panel 114 fixed effects, more can make thing to be detected and collector laminating closely.
As the further improvement of technique scheme, above-mentioned control panel 114 is spoon shape.When thing to be detected is fruit, spoon shape control panel 114 is connected with sliding panel 113, spoon shape control panel 114 is more suitable for than the control panel of other shapes 114, and the profile of control panel 114 of spoon shape is close with the profile of fruit, the fruit surface of more fitting fixedly time.
As the further improvement of technique scheme, control panel 114 is used flexible material, such as rubber, uses flexible material can not cause damage to thing to be detected, and can make thing to be detected and camera lens 13 more fit.
Further improvement as technique scheme, the shell of main frame 2 is provided with adsorbent equipment 21, it can be sucker, also can be that other can be adsorbed on the device on another object by an object, adsorbent equipment 21 is distributed in respectively on four angles of main frame 2 housings, be used for adsorbing notebook computer, saving takes up room.After detection completes, by the data upload detecting in computer.
As the further improvement of technique scheme, two relative edges of main frame 2 are provided with one group of double-shoulder belt 22, in the wild, use double-shoulder belt to carry on the back the single shoulder belt of 22 negative ratio and bear more laborsavingly, make people lighter.
